Vinyl window installation involves replacing existing windows with new, durable vinyl frames designed to enhance a property's appearance and functionality. This service typically includes removing old or damaged windows, preparing the opening for the new units, and securely installing the vinyl frames to ensure proper operation. The process aims to improve energy efficiency, reduce outside noise, and provide a low-maintenance solution that withstands weather conditions over time. Homeowners considering vinyl window installation typically do so when existing windows are outdated, damaged, or no longer provide adequate insulation. Common signs include drafts, condensation between panes, difficulty operating the windows, or visible deterioration. Choosing to upgrade with vinyl windows can make a noticeable difference in home comfort and energy savings. The overview below groups typical Vinyl Window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Easton, PA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- The typical cost for minor vinyl window repairs or replacements in Easton, PA ranges from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the window size and extent of work needed.
Standard Window Replacement - Replacing a standard vinyl window usually costs between $1,000 and $3,000 per window. Most projects in this category stay within this range, with fewer reaching higher prices for custom or larger units.
Full Home Window Upgrade - A full vinyl window installation for an entire home can range from $10,000 to $25,000 or more. Larger, more complex projects tend to reach the higher end of this spectrum, while many homes fall into the mid-range.
Custom or High-End Projects - High-end vinyl window installations with custom features or multiple specialty windows can exceed $5,000 per window. These projects are less common and typically involve premium materials or intricate designs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are the benefits of choosing vinyl windows? Vinyl windows are known for their durability, low maintenance needs, and energy efficiency, making them a popular choice for many homeowners in Easton, PA.
How do local contractors handle vinyl window installation? Local service providers typically assess the existing window openings, select appropriate vinyl window styles, and ensure proper installation for optimal performance and longevity.
Are there different styles of vinyl windows available? Yes, local contractors offer various styles such as double-hung, casement, sliding, and picture windows to match different aesthetic preferences and functional needs.
What should I consider when selecting vinyl windows for my home? Consider factors like window style, energy efficiency features, frame color, and compatibility with your home's architecture, with guidance from local pros.
Can vinyl window installation improve my home's energy efficiency? Properly installed vinyl windows can help reduce energy loss, contributing to better insulation and potentially lowering energy bills.
